Moving Object detection is a crucial researching issue in computer vision field, which has widely applicative prospects in video surveillance, transportation, medical research and the military field etc. With in-depth study about this theory conducted by the researchers both domestic and overseas, moving object detection technology has been rapidly developed.The paper puts the intelligent surveillance video analysis techniques as research background, aiming the true complexity of the environment, discusses the interfering factors such as the illumination changes, shadows, scene itself changes and moving background. In response to these problems, we study some commonly used moving object detection algorithms and give the comparative analysis of these theoretical principles and results. Subsequently, this paper sums up the characteristics of their respective. Particularly, we conduct a research into the background modeling algorithm in moving object detection, discuss background subtraction and frame difference method respectively. Besides that, we analyze the theoretical results and then draw the conclusion that the algorithms have pertinence to the scenes. On the foundation of this, in this paper, we propose a region of motion and change detection algorithm of moving object algorithm. The algorithm sets up two background subtractions and frame difference methods. At the region changing level, it integrates background subtraction into implement foreground detection. In order to make sure that the background can inhibit the effect of shadows. Photometric invariant color in RGB color space is used in color model matching for making background robust to illumination changes. In the process of removing the shadow of this paper, based on the HSV space and the RGB space of the method of combination, we remove the shadow for being a real prospect of goals effectively.In this paper, we implement the proposed method and evaluate the performance of our method on real scenes. The experimental results prove that our method can apply to the complex scene under illumination conditions, at the same time, it can reduce external interference, such as the light changes, moving background (branches swaying) and shadow impact. Finally, this paper compares the proposed methods with Gaussian mixture modeling, by analyzing the contrast results. Additionally, the compares obtain the proposed methods having strong accuracy and robustness under complex environment containing shadows and moving background.
